That could also be said for the company itself, hence the name. Their website is under construction but Robust Flavor provided a nice summary of the One People Project mission:

One People Project highlights the value of individuality while celebrating fundamental oneness in all peoples. Based out of Southern California, their premium collection of apparel is beautifully crafted with emphasis on design, fit, and feel. One People Project is the self-proclaimed "blue-collar creative brand."
